Pakistan have made one change for the ICC World Cup 2023 match against New Zealand at the M Chinnaswamy Stadium in Bengaluru today.

Pacer Hasan Ali has replaced leg-spinner Usama Mir in the Pakistan team.

New Zealand have also made three changes with skipper Kane Williamson returning along with Mark Chapman and Ish Sodhi. 

Lineups

Pakistan: Abdullah Shafique, Fakhar Zaman, Babar Azam (c), Mohammad Rizwan (wk), Saud Shakeel, Iftikhar Ahmed, Agha Salman, Mohammad Wasim, Hasan Ali, Shaheen Shah Afridi, Haris Rauf.

New Zealand: Devon Conway, Rachin Ravindra, Kane Williamson (c), Daryl Mitchell, Tom Latham (wk), Glenn Phillips, Mark Chapman, Mitchell Santner, Ish Sodhi, Tim Southee, Trent Boult

Pakistan’s match against New Zealand is also likely to be affected by rain. According to the latest weather update, there are more than 90 percent chances of rain between 2-4pm local time.

It must be noted that the match will start at 10:30 local time, which means that the second half of the encounter could be affected by rain.

According to ICC regulations, an additional hour will be given to complete the match in case there are rain interruptions.

Pakistan made a comeback in the tournament after suffering four consecutive defeats — against India, Australia, Afghanistan, and South Africa — as they beat Bangladesh by seven wickets in their last match in Kolkata.

On the other hand, despite a bright start and having four out of four wins at one point, the Black Caps suffered three consecutive defeats — India, Australia and South Africa.

A defeat to either of the teams tomorrow would seriously damage their chances of playing the event's semi-final, Pakistan especially since they are not just behind in net run rate (NRR) but now also have to rely on Afghanistan's matches after Hashmatullah Shahidi's men clinched a significant win against the Netherlands on Friday.
